Does Texas Medicaid cover ABA therapy?

Yes, Texas Medicaid covers ABA therapy for children with an autism diagnosis when it is medically necessary. Coverage depends on eligibility and requires prior authorization.

Texas Medicaid provides coverage for ABA therapy when it is considered medically necessary for a child with an autism diagnosis. Unlike some plans, coverage is based on clinical need, not a fixed annual hour limit.

To access services, families typically need to:

  • Qualify for Texas Medicaid
  • Have a documented autism diagnosis
  • Complete an authorization process before starting therapy

Because approval and coverage details can vary, it can help to review Texas Medicaid coverage for ABA therapy and understand what your specific plan requires.

Many families are able to access ongoing ABA support through Medicaid, especially when working with providers who handle authorization and paperwork.
